
Rustin
(2023)Bayard Rustin, an influential advocate for gay civil rights, played a pivotal role in the coordination of the historic 1963 March on Washington, joining forces with Martin Luther King Jr. and a group of passionate individuals. Together, they orchestrated a momentous event aimed at bringing about social change and equality. Rustin's unwavering dedication to the cause served as a driving force behind the successful mobilization of thousands of participants, who united in their quest for justice and freedom. This collaboration between Rustin, King Jr., and their comrades not only highlighted the importance of unity but also underlined the intersectionality of various civil rights movements, uniting marginalized communities in the pursuit of a brighter future.
